A heavy, block-forward slab serif with broad proportions and tightly managed counters. Serifs are squared and bracketed, creating a sturdy, poster-like silhouette with clear horizontal anchoring. Curves are generously rounded while joins stay compact, producing a dense, even texture; several letters show subtle notch-like shaping at inner corners that reads as pragmatic detailing for clarity at large sizes. Numerals and capitals carry a uniform, impactful weight, and the lowercase maintains solid presence with short ascenders/descenders and robust bowls.

This font excels in short, high-impact applications such as headlines, posters, storefront or wayfinding signage, and bold brand marks. Its sturdy slabs and dense color also suit packaging, labels, and editorial display moments where a strong, confident voice is needed.

The overall tone is forceful and dependable, with a workmanlike, no-nonsense voice that feels at home in heritage and utility contexts. It also carries a familiar collegiate and signage energy—bold, confident, and meant to be read quickly.

The design appears intended to deliver maximum presence with a stable, grounded structure—combining classic slab-serif cues with simplified, modernized geometry for clear, emphatic display typography.

In text settings the rhythm is strongly horizontal and the color is very dark, so the face feels best when given breathing room (larger sizes or looser tracking/leading). The slab terminals and wide letterforms create strong word shapes, while the compact apertures and dense counters emphasize impact over delicacy.
